How long should I soak raw oats before eating? Oats should soak for at least 12 hours but 24 is best, and a little longer is ok too.

(You … WebIn a mason jar or other glass container with lid, add the oats, desired amount of milk, and desired amount of honey. If desired, add chia seeds and cinnamon (recommend including them for extra texture and flavor) Stir to combine well. Add yogurt if you'd like. Stir and cover with lid. Chill overnight.
